开发大型网站的人员核心在于构建高并发、高可用且安全合规的分布式架构体系,其关键能力已从单一编码转向全链路性能优化与自动化运维协同。

在2026年的数字化浪潮中,大型网站已不再是简单的信息展示平台,而是承载亿级用户交互、实时数据处理与复杂业务逻辑的核心枢纽,开发这类系统的团队,不再仅仅是“写代码的人”,而是系统架构师、性能工程师与安全专家的综合体。
大型网站开发的核心挑战与架构演进
随着5G普及与AI深度集成,大型网站面临着前所未有的流量峰值与技术复杂度,传统的单体架构或简单的微服务架构已无法支撑日均千万级PV(页面浏览量)的需求。
分布式架构的深度实践
现代大型网站普遍采用云原生分布式架构,根据2026年中国信通院发布的《云计算发展白皮书》显示,超过85%的大型互联网企业已完成核心业务上云,并采用混合云部署策略。
- 服务治理:通过Service Mesh(服务网格)实现细粒度的流量控制与服务发现,确保在部分节点故障时,系统仍能保持99.99%的高可用性。
- 数据一致性:在分布式环境下,解决CAP定理中的矛盾成为关键,主流方案采用最终一致性模型,结合Saga模式或TCC(尝试-确认-完成)协议,确保金融级交易的数据准确无误。
- 边缘计算协同:为了降低延迟,大型网站将静态资源与部分动态计算下沉至边缘节点,实现“源站-边缘-用户”的三级加速,将首屏加载时间控制在200毫秒以内。
高并发下的性能优化策略
性能优化是大型网站开发的“生命线”,2026年,头部大厂如阿里云、酷番云公开的技术案例表明,多级缓存策略与异步削峰是应对洪峰流量的标配。

- 多级缓存体系:构建“浏览器缓存 -> CDN缓存 -> 本地缓存(Caffeine) -> 分布式缓存(Redis Cluster) -> 数据库”的五层防护网。
- 异步化处理:利用消息队列(如Kafka、RocketMQ)将非核心业务(如发送通知、记录日志)异步化,核心交易链路吞吐量提升300%以上。
- 数据库分库分表:针对海量数据,采用ShardingSphere等中间件进行垂直与水平拆分,并结合读写分离技术,减轻主库压力。
关键技术与人才能力模型
开发大型网站的人员需要具备跨领域的综合能力,2026年招聘市场数据显示,具备全栈开发能力且精通DevOps的工程师薪资溢价高达40%。
核心技术栈要求
| 技术领域 | 2026年主流技术选型 | 核心应用场景 |
|---|---|---|
| 前端框架 | Vue 3 / React 19 + WebAssembly | 复杂交互、高性能渲染、离线应用 |
| 后端语言 | Go / Rust / Java 21 | 高并发服务、微服务治理、系统底层优化 |
| 数据库 | TiDB / OceanBase / PostgreSQL | 分布式事务、HTAP混合负载分析 |
| 容器化 | Kubernetes + Docker | 自动化部署、弹性伸缩、资源隔离 |
安全与合规性建设
在《数据安全法》与《个人信息保护法》日益严格的背景下,安全不再是附加项,而是开发前置条件。
- 零信任架构:摒弃传统的边界防御,实施“永不信任,始终验证”的内部网络访问控制。
- 隐私计算:采用联邦学习或多方安全计算技术,在数据不出域的前提下实现联合建模,满足隐私保护合规要求。
- 自动化安全测试:将SAST(静态应用安全测试)与DAST(动态应用安全测试)集成至CI/CD流水线,实现代码提交即扫描,漏洞修复率提升至95%以上。
实战经验与行业最佳实践
参考2026年京东、美团等头部企业的技术分享,大型网站开发的成功案例往往源于对细节的极致追求。
场景化解决方案
- 秒杀场景:采用“库存预扣减+本地锁+消息队列异步下单”方案,有效防止超卖与数据库击穿,某电商平台在2026年双11期间,通过该方案支撑了每秒100万笔订单的处理能力。
- 全球加速场景:针对出海业务,构建全球内容分发网络(GCDN),结合智能路由算法,将海外用户访问延迟降低40%。
团队协作与DevOps文化
大型网站开发不再是单打独斗,而是高度协同的结果。

- 敏捷开发:采用Scrum框架,以两周为一个迭代周期,快速响应市场变化。
- 自动化运维:通过GitOps实现基础设施即代码(IaC),确保环境一致性,减少人为错误。
- 监控与告警:建立全链路监控体系,涵盖APM(应用性能监控)、日志分析与业务指标监控,实现故障分钟级定位与恢复。
常见问题解答(FAQ)
Q1: 2026年开发大型网站,选择Java还是Go语言更合适?
A: 两者各有优势,Java生态成熟,适合复杂业务逻辑与大型团队协同;Go语言并发性能优异,资源占用低,适合高并发微服务与底层基础设施,建议核心交易链路使用Go,业务中台使用Java,根据团队技术储备与项目需求权衡。
Q2: 如何评估大型网站架构的稳定性?
A: 主要看三个指标:可用性(SLA,通常要求99.99%以上)、响应时间(P99延迟)、以及故障恢复时间(MTTR),建议定期进行混沌工程演练,模拟节点故障、网络延迟等异常场景,验证系统的自愈能力。
Q3: 大型网站开发中,如何平衡新功能开发与系统重构?
A: 采用“绞杀者模式”(Strangler Fig Pattern),逐步将旧系统功能迁移至新架构,避免一次性重构带来的高风险,设立“技术债”专项,每个迭代预留20%资源用于代码优化与架构改进。
您是否正在面临大型网站架构升级的难题?欢迎在评论区分享您的具体场景,我们将提供针对性建议。
参考文献
- 中国信息通信研究院. (2026). 《2026年中国云计算产业发展白皮书》. 北京: 中国信通院.
- 阿里巴巴集团技术团队. (2025). 《云原生分布式数据库架构演进与实践》. 杭州: 阿里云技术博客.
- 腾讯研究院. (2026). 《大型互联网系统高可用架构设计指南》. 深圳: 腾讯科技.
- 王坚, 等. (2025). 《数据驱动的大型网站性能优化策略研究》. 计算机学报, 48(3), 112-125.
图片来源于AI模型,如侵权请联系管理员。作者:酷小编,如若转载,请注明出处:https://www.kufanyun.com/ask/516753.html


评论列表(2条)
读了这篇文章,我深有感触。作者对采用的理解非常深刻,论述也很有逻辑性。内容既有理论深度,又有实践指导意义,确实是一篇值得细细品味的好文章。希望作者能继续创作更多优秀的作品!
这篇文章的内容非常有价值,我从中学习到了很多新的知识和观点。作者的写作风格简洁明了,却又不失深度,让人读起来很舒服。特别是采用部分,给了我很多新的思路。感谢分享这么好的内容!